DP09800901_CASALMAIOCCO is an advanced wastewater treatment plant located in Casalmaiocco, a municipality in the province of Lodi, Lombardy, Italy. The plant serves a population of 2,632 and has a designed capacity of 5,300 m³/day, with a discharge volume of 521.04 m³/day. It operates under Italy's implementation of the EU Urban Waste Water Treatment Directive (91/271/EEC), which requires appropriate treatment for small agglomerations. The plant provides advanced treatment, which goes beyond secondary treatment to remove nutrients such as nitrogen and phosphorus. This level of treatment is typical for plants discharging into sensitive areas or upstream of water bodies used for drinking water abstraction. The plant's capacity utilization is low relative to its design, indicating potential for future growth or seasonal variability. The treated effluent is discharged into local watercourses that eventually drain into the Po River basin, one of Italy's most significant watersheds. The Po River flows eastward into the Adriatic Sea, supporting extensive agricultural irrigation and diverse aquatic ecosystems. The advanced treatment helps protect downstream water quality and ecological health.
Environmental context
The plant discharges into local waterways that are part of the Po River basin. The Po River is the longest river in Italy, flowing through the Po Valley and emptying into the Adriatic Sea. This basin supports intensive agriculture and is ecologically sensitive due to nutrient loading. Advanced treatment at this plant reduces nitrogen and phosphorus inputs, helping to mitigate eutrophication risks in the Adriatic Sea.
